Full Job Description

The WH Scott Group are seeking to hire a People Specialist to join our team in the UK. This is an exciting opportunity for a HR professional who is passionate about people, compliance, and employee well-being in a rapidly growing business.
The role of the People Specialist in the UK division is to guide and support the Management team in each of the business units across the UK, to ensure the smooth running of the company from a people perspective.
This role covers several locations in the UK (London, Plymouth, Bristol, Southampton, Yeovil, Leicester).
This position can be based in any of the following locations: London, Plymouth, Bristol or Belfast. Travel to site will be required occasionally.
This role will report to the Chief Human Resource Officer (CHRO)
Responsibilities:
HR Operations
· Manage all aspects of the employee lifecycle, from recruitment and onboarding to retention and exit processes.
· Liaising with the Talent Acquisition Specialist on UK recruitment, from business case approval to preparation of contracts, this will also include liaising with the Hiring Manager to ensure all job specs are up to date
· Managing talent pools and succession plans in liaison with the Training Manager and the Talent Acquisition Specialist
· Carrying out new employee inductions
· Roll out employee workshops across the group in both the UK & ROI on topics that will enhance the employee experience and empower employees
· Provide ongoing support to the Management Team on performance management, annual reviews, policy implementation and any other topics they may need support on
· Partnering with senior operational staff including the CHRO, to establish and roll-out people-related strategy
· Support employees who are exiting the business and assist Management with the exit process ensuring an exit interview is carried out by their Manager or HR
Employee Relations
· Provide guidance and support to the Management team on employment relations issues such as disciplinaries, grievances and employee welfare on a day to day basis across the UK
Administration
· Administration of employee-related paperwork, such as employment contracts, new starter packs, and the maintenance of the HR System (currently Bright HR), ensuring all leave records are kept up to date
· Monthly payroll administration
Policy & Procedure Implementation
· Ensuring all company policies and procedures are in line with UK legislation and best practise, and are followed consistently across each of the UK business units
· Developing and implementing HR policies and procedures that align with the WH Scott Group goals and objectives set by the Senior Management Team
Training & Development
· Work closely with the Training department to oversee training and development of all UK employees
Staff Well-being & Engagement
· Promote staff welfare initiatives, recognition schemes, and HR-led activities
· Develop and implement employee retention and employee engagement programmes
· Work with the CHRO to carry out employee surveys
· Absence Management - Support the Management Team with absence management in their area including occupational health, and wellbeing referrals
HR Audits & Reporting
· Conduct internal audits
· Providing monthly detailed HR reports for UK divisions
Any other ad hoc duties as assigned by the CHRO or the CEO of the WH Scott Group
